Why SafetyPals
Safety learning should grow with the child.
Children move through many everyday settings — at home, on roads, in schools, online and in public spaces. Learning how to stay safe in each of them is one of the most useful skills a child can build.
Yet safety education is often fragmented across topics, delivered as one-off talks, or pitched at the wrong age. SafetyPals takes a calm, structured and age-appropriate approach instead — building understanding step by step, and always pointing children towards a trusted adult when they need help.

Three age pathways
Age-appropriate from ages 4 to 17.
Each pathway is designed for how children think and learn at that stage.
- Phase A · Ages 4–6
Early Years
Gentle first ideas about safe and unsafe situations through play, stories and simple routines, always alongside a trusted grown-up.
Learn more - Phase B · Ages 6–10
Primary Years
Recognising everyday risks, practising safe choices, and knowing how and when to ask a trusted adult for help.
Learn more - Phase C · Ages 11–17
Teen Years
Confident decision-making, personal and online safety, first aid and emergency response, and age-appropriate life skills.

What children learn
Everyday safety, made understandable.
Clear, friendly topics that fit real life at home, at school and in the community.
Road & Transport Safety
Crossing safely, school transport habits, and staying visible near traffic.
Stranger & Personal Safety
Trusting instincts, keeping a safe distance, and reaching a trusted adult.
Safe & Unsafe Touch
Body safety, personal boundaries, and confident help-seeking.
Fire, Water & Home Safety
Fire, water, electrical and everyday home hazards, handled calmly.
Bullying & Cyber Safety
Kind behaviour, staying safe online, and speaking up early.
First Aid & Emergencies
Simple first response and how to call for help in an emergency.
Medicine & Kitchen Safety
Safe habits around medicines, kitchens and household products.
Puberty & Life Skills
Age-appropriate puberty, period awareness and adolescent life skills.
How SafetyPals works
A simple, repeatable learning model.
The same four steps carry through every topic and every age group.
- 01
Learn
Children explore ideas through age-appropriate stories and discussion.
- 02
Practise
Activities and role-play let children rehearse safe choices in a supportive setting.
- 03
Reinforce
Teachers and parents revisit the same ideas at school and at home.
- 04
Apply
Children build the confidence to make safe decisions and ask for help when it matters.
